Chicago Bears at Atlanta Falcons (October 7, 2001)

Game Recap


In a October 7 week 4 meeting, the Bears pitched a strong 31-3 victory against the Falcons. After the Bears led after the second quarter, the Bears jumped in front late and rolled to a comfortable victory.

The Bears were led by Jim Miller who tossed in 196 yards passing, 1 TD, was 17 of 26 passing. Anthony Thomas rumbled for 1 touchdown. Marcus Robinson caught 114 yards receiving, 1 TD, 9 receptions.

For the Falcons, Michael Vick connected on 186 yards in the air, zero interceptions, was 12 of 18 passing.

The Bears finished with 300 total yards, 15 first downs, 2 turnovers and 5 penalties. They were 4 of 11 on third downs. The Falcons finished with 335 total yards, 19 first downs, 5 turnovers and 6 penalties. They were 6 of 12 on third downs.
